Q: Is 9,334,702 a Prime Number?

 A: No, 9,334,702 is not a prime number.

Why is 9,334,702 not a prime number?

A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.

The number 9334702 can be evenly divided by 1 2 13 26 359,027 718,054 4,667,351 and 9,334,702, with no remainder.

Since 9,334,702 cannot be divided by just 1 and 9,334,702, it is not a prime number.
